Chapter 194: Still Need to Take a Closer Look

Qi Yuansheng was stunned at first, then he realized—Su He had just cursed him as if he were already dead!

Suppressing his displeasure, he said, “Little He, I know you’re still angry at me, but I had no choice. The difference in our social status was just too great; we could never be together. And Ruyi has always been deeply devoted to me, so I chose to be with her…”

Su He interrupted him, “Don’t flatter yourself. Just call it what it is—you were climbing the social ladder.

Deeply devoted to you?

Pah! In her eyes, you’re nothing more than a lapdog! She teases you when she’s in a good mood, and kicks you away when she’s not!”

Qi Yuansheng’s face instantly turned ugly. “Little He, I know you have resentment in your heart, but that doesn’t mean you should speak so harshly. Let the past stay in the past. We may not be lovers, but we can still be friends—”

Su He cut him off again, “What, now I’m supposed to smile and be friendly with a heartless scumbag like you?

Your breakup letter was clear as day—you’ve moved up in the world and I’m not good enough for you, so we should go our separate ways. And now you want to be friends?

You trying to act all noble is disgusting!

I’m a decent, respectable girl—unless I’ve completely lost my mind, there’s no way I’d be friends with trash like you.”

Qi Yuansheng was fuming. Pointing at her, he said, “Little He, I didn’t expect you to be this kind of person—”

Su He snapped, “What kind of person? Isn’t this all thanks to you?!

You chased money and status, dumped me, and I was so devastated I tried to drown myself in the river. Qi Yuansheng, if you had even a shred of conscience, you wouldn’t be standing here trying to play the good guy!

And now you shamelessly want to be friends? Just so you can take advantage of me?

You scumbag! You ruined me once, and now you want to ruin me again?!”

As she spoke, her voice broke and her face twisted with grief and anger.

Although Principal Chen knew Su He wasn’t the type to suffer silently, he couldn’t help but step forward.

He stood protectively in front of her and barked at Qi Yuansheng, “Get lost! If I see you harassing Little Su again, don’t blame me for what happens!”

There were quite a few people waiting for the bus at the station. With not much else to entertain them, everyone had been listening intently to the drama.

This was a time when people still valued decency, and soon the crowd began speaking out in defense of Su He.

“You pushed a girl to the point of jumping into a river, and now you’ve got the nerve to ask to be friends?”

“Exactly. Bet he’s got dirty thoughts just ‘cause the girl’s pretty!”

“So young and already mooching off women. Shameless!”

Qi Yuansheng was so mad he could’ve coughed up blood!

“It’s not how she’s making it sound—listen to me—”

Before he could explain, the bus arrived.

Su He and Principal Chen boarded.

Qi Yuansheng managed to squeeze on as well, but several passengers promptly shoved him back out.

Pah!
You Chen Shimei*!
Get lost and stay lost!
(*Chen Shimei is a historical byword in Chinese culture for a two-faced, heartless man.)

He fell flat on his back, his books scattered all over the ground.

By the time he scrambled to his feet, the bus had already driven off.

He was absolutely furious!

Especially when he noticed some pages of the books were torn. His expression darkened even further.

Ruyi had asked him to buy those. If she saw the damage, she’d definitely be upset.

Thinking of Shen Ruyi, he couldn’t help but recall what Su He had said—how in her eyes, he was just a lapdog…

He shook his head violently.
Su He—that damn woman—must’ve said that on purpose.
Ruyi’s feelings for him were real. They had to be!

On the bus, Principal Chen looked worried but didn’t say anything—too many ears around.

When they finally got off, he asked, “Little Su, are you okay?”

Su He chuckled, “Of course I’m fine. That kind of scumbag isn’t worth getting upset over. I was just using the power of the people to drown him in the sea of public opinion.”

Principal Chen finally relaxed, though he was still puzzled.

With Little Su’s personality, how could she have ever liked such a lowlife?

Just as he was wondering, Su He grinned and said, “Principal, you’re probably wondering why I ever liked someone like that, huh?

It’s simple. I must’ve been blind back then!

Don’t worry, I’ve got my eyes wide open now. No way I’m making the same mistake twice.

The one I’m dating now—mm, my current boyfriend—is a thousand times better than that scumbag. Totally reliable.”

Principal Chen advised seriously, “It takes time to know someone’s true nature. Just be cautious. You’re still young—wait seven or eight years before getting married. There’s no rush.”

Su He nodded, “I agree! I want to focus more of my energy on helping build An County. When the people here are living better lives, then I’ll think about marriage.”

Principal Chen was deeply gratified.
Little Su’s sense of duty was truly admirable!

On the way back, Su He struck up a lively conversation with the bus conductor. By the time she got off the bus, she had gained another “big sister”!

Principal Chen wasn’t even surprised anymore.
Typical Su He.

The next morning, Su He arrived at the machinery factory.

Secretary Yang looked at her with a half-smile and said, “Little Su, your job as secretary seems a lot easier than mine. I have to be here by 7 every morning to help Director Hu clean the office. After all, I’m the only one with a key.”

In other words, she was flaunting her status as Director Hu’s trusted aide.

Su He smiled, “Sister Yang, Director Hu trusts you so much—it’s only natural you have to shoulder more responsibility.”

Secretary Yang’s face lit with pride.
As long as you know your place!

You’re just a young newcomer. Even if you’re capable, so what?

Might just be a flash in the pan—back to square one in no time.

Little did she know, Su He didn’t care enough to argue. Out of respect for Director Hu, she didn’t want to stir up trouble.

A while later, Director Hu arrived.

As he passed the secretaries’ office, he glanced in, saw Su He, and smiled, “Little Su, you’re here? Have you picked up your welfare package yet?”

Secretary Yang froze, quickly saying, “Director, Little Su just arrived today—I haven’t had a chance to tell her about it yet.”

Director Hu didn’t mind, smiling, “No problem. Little Su, make sure to stop by the union office before you leave today.”

Su He beamed, thanked him, and happily followed Director Hu to his office.

“Director, I heard our factory is assigning housing?”

Director Hu frowned slightly. “Little Su, are you hoping to get an apartment?”

It wasn’t that he didn’t want to give her one. The issue was she was too new. If she got a unit so soon, it would surely stir resentment.

Su He smiled, “Director, I might lack many things, but I don’t lack self-awareness. I’m new here—what right do I have to ask for a place?”

Director Hu breathed a sigh of relief.
That’s more like it. Little Su really knew her place.

“Then why are you asking?” he said.

Su He awakens to find herself reborn into a 1970s-era novel as a fake heiress who’s been sent back to her hometown. In the story, the real heiress—the ungrateful “white-eyed wolf”—lives a charmed, scheming life while the Su family spirals into ruin and the original heroine suffers beyond endurance. But Su He remains calm, for wherever people gather, that’s her stage! With a few clever ploys, the eight hundred scheming family members begin competing with each other and clinging to her, crying as they vie to ride her coattails. She trades resources, reads people flawlessly, counsels and advises one after another—earning eighty‑eight wages until her hands cramp. She builds up her hometown and lifts up her country; after all, "Good People of An County, That’s Me!" Does the real heiress still want to play her scheming games? Sorry, but An County is packed with relatives—and they’re like living CCTV, watching every move in 360 degrees! Mini‐Scene 1: On the train from An County to “Magic City” (i.e. Shanghai), Su He is chatting warmly with foreign guests. Principal Chen is worried. Old Gu asks, “Are you afraid little Su will be deceived by these foreigners?” Principal Chen shakes his head. “No—I’m afraid those foreigners will be deceived by her!” Mini‐Scene 2: Someone questions whether Su He even has a real job. Su He opens her shoulder bag and starts pulling out credentials: Liaison Officer of the Huaihua Commune Special Correspondent certificate Instructor at An County Evening School… The questioner is left speechless: “…Are you just a certificate collector?!”
